Open Source ERP Software is an enterprise resource planning system where the source code is publicly available. Businesses can modify, customize, and extend the software according to their operational requirements.
Unlike traditional ERP software, open source ERP gives manufacturers greater flexibility, better control over customization, and lower licensing costs.
The software integrates multiple departments into one centralized system, enabling seamless communication and real-time data sharing across the organization.

In 2026, the landscape for Open Source ERP in manufacturing has shifted from "basic alternatives" to strategic, enterprise-grade solutions. Modern manufacturers are increasingly leveraging these platforms to avoid vendor lock-in, eliminate per-user licensing fees, and gain granular control over their digital infrastructure.
| Software | Best For | Manufacturing Strengths |
| ERPNext | SMEs & Growing Manufacturers | Complete "out-of-the-box" manufacturing suite (BOM, MRP, Work Orders, Subcontracting). |
| Odoo | Mid-market & Modular Needs | Highly modular; massive ecosystem of apps; user-friendly interface. |
| Apache OFBiz | Large/Complex Customizations | Robust, highly extensible framework for complex, niche manufacturing processes. |
| iDempiere | Enterprise Scalability | Plugin-based, highly stable, and capable of managing complex supply chains. |
| Tryton | Technical/Dev-Centric Teams | Modular, secure architecture; ideal for companies requiring deep data integrity. |
When vetting these systems, ensure the solution supports the following 2026-standard requirements:
Production Management: Advanced Bill of Materials (BOM) management, including multi-level and "Phantom" BOMs.
Capacity Planning: Real-time visibility into workstation workloads to prevent bottlenecks.
Subcontracting: Native support for managing external job work, including material transfers and GST compliance (if operating in India).
Quality Assurance: Integrated non-conformance reporting, inspection plans, and quality analytics.
Traceability: End-to-end tracking of serial numbers and batches from raw material procurement to finished goods.
Cost Control: By removing per-user licensing fees, you can reallocate capital expenditure toward custom process optimization and hardware.
Process Freedom: Unlike proprietary systems that force you to adapt your workflows to their "standard," open-source code allows you to modify the software to fit your unique production floor.
Independence: You own your data and code. You are free to switch between service partners without the threat of system obsolescence.
Expertise Requirement: "Open source" does not mean "maintenance-free."
Hidden Costs: While the software is "free," budget for implementation, hosting, data migration, and custom development.
Governance: Increased flexibility requires strict project governance to prevent "feature creep" or overly complex, unmaintainable customizations.
Define Requirements: Document your specific manufacturing mode (e.g., Job Shop, Make-to-Order, Discrete).
Shortlist: Pick 2–3 platforms that align with your technical team's proficiency (e.g., Python/Frappe for ERPNext vs. Java for iDempiere).
Partner Vetting: For enterprise deployments, work with a certified partner.
Phased Rollout: Start with core modules (Inventory, Procurement, Basic MRP) before moving to advanced features like Shop Floor Control or IoT machine integration.
